Tool profile
Open code React component system built with Tailwind CSS and Radix primitives.
Internal dashboards needing polished UI quickly
Not an npm package you version like a black box—CLI copies accessible React components built on Radix primitives and Tailwind tokens into your codebase.
shadcn/ui components are MIT-licensed patterns you own and modify. There is no shadcn subscription for the open distribution—cost is engineering time, Tailwind pipeline, Radix bundle size awareness, and hosting.
Ideal when you want design-system speed without fighting opaque component library upgrade cycles you cannot patch.

Pricing snapshot
shadcn/ui's core distribution is free under MIT-style open-source licensing. There is no shadcn subscription for the components themselves; the real cost is engineering time, your Tailwind and React stack, and the hosting or app infrastructure around the code you copy into your repo.
